Re: [PATCH V2 5/8] x86/platform/uv: Add UV Hubbed/Hubless Proc FS Files

2019-09-11 Thread Mike Travis




On 9/10/2019 11:04 PM, Ingo Molnar wrote:


* Mike Travis  wrote:


@@ -1596,7 +1687,7 @@ static void __init uv_system_init_hub(vo
uv_nmi_setup();
uv_cpu_init();
uv_scir_register_cpu_notifier();
-   proc_mkdir("sgi_uv", NULL);
+   uv_setup_proc_files(0);


This slipped through previously: platform drivers have absolutely no
business mucking in /proc.

Please describe the hardware via sysfs as pretty much everyone else does.

Thanks,

Ingo



If I was doing it now I definitely would put it in the sysfs realm.  The 
problem is Jack did it back in (I think) 2007.  The earliest commit I 
could find:


commit a3d732f93785da17e0137210deadb4616f5536fc
Author: Cliff Wickman 
Date:   Mon Nov 10 16:16:31 2008 -0600

x86, UV: fix redundant creation of sgi_uv

Impact: fix double entry creation in /proc

And in the past 12 years probably a hundred user programs are now keying 
of the presence of /proc/sgi_uv to signal this is indeed a UV system. 
Changing the location of this node also affects all the UV utilities 
including those not written by us.

[PATCH V2 5/8] x86/platform/uv: Add UV Hubbed/Hubless Proc FS Files

2019-09-10 Thread Mike Travis
Indicate to UV user utilities that UV hubless support is available on
this system via the existing /proc infterface.  The current interface is
maintained with the addition of new /proc leaves ("hubbed", "hubless",
and "oemid") that contain the specific type of UV arch this one is.

Signed-off-by: Mike Travis 
Reviewed-by: Steve Wahl 
Reviewed-by: Dimitri Sivanich 
---
V2: Remove is_uv_hubbed define
Remove leading '_' from _is_uv_hubbed
---
 arch/x86/include/asm/uv/uv.h   |4 +
 arch/x86/kernel/apic/x2apic_uv_x.c |   93 -
 2 files changed, 96 insertions(+), 1 deletion(-)

--- linux.orig/arch/x86/include/asm/uv/uv.h
+++ linux/arch/x86/include/asm/uv/uv.h
@@ -12,6 +12,8 @@ struct mm_struct;
 #ifdef CONFIG_X86_UV
 #include 
 
+#defineUV_PROC_NODE"sgi_uv"
+
 static inline int uv(int uvtype)
 {
/* uv(0) is "any" */
@@ -28,6 +30,7 @@ static inline bool is_early_uv_system(vo
return uv_systab_phys && uv_systab_phys != EFI_INVALID_TABLE_ADDR;
 }
 extern int is_uv_system(void);
+extern int is_uv_hubbed(int uvtype);
 extern int is_uv_hubless(int uvtype);
 extern void uv_cpu_init(void);
 extern void uv_nmi_init(void);
@@ -40,6 +43,7 @@ extern const struct cpumask *uv_flush_tl
 static inline enum uv_system_type get_uv_system_type(void) { return UV_NONE; }
 static inline bool is_early_uv_system(void){ return 0; }
 static inline int is_uv_system(void)   { return 0; }
+static inline int is_uv_hubbed(int uv) { return 0; }
 static inline int is_uv_hubless(int uv) { return 0; }
 static inline void uv_cpu_init(void)   { }
 static inline void uv_system_init(void){ }
--- linux.orig/arch/x86/kernel/apic/x2apic_uv_x.c
+++ linux/arch/x86/kernel/apic/x2apic_uv_x.c
@@ -26,6 +26,7 @@
 static DEFINE_PER_CPU(int, x2apic_extra_bits);
 
 static enum uv_system_type uv_system_type;
+static int uv_hubbed_system;
 static int uv_hubless_system;
 static u64 gru_start_paddr, gru_end_paddr;
 static u64 gru_dist_base, gru_first_node_paddr = -1LL, 
gru_last_node_paddr;
@@ -309,6 +310,24 @@ static int __init uv_acpi_madt_oem_check
if (uv_hub_info->hub_revision == 0)
goto badbios;
 
+   switch (uv_hub_info->hub_revision) {
+   case UV4_HUB_REVISION_BASE:
+   uv_hubbed_system = 0x11;
+   break;
+
+   case UV3_HUB_REVISION_BASE:
+   uv_hubbed_system = 0x9;
+   break;
+
+   case UV2_HUB_REVISION_BASE:
+   uv_hubbed_system = 0x5;
+   break;
+
+   case UV1_HUB_REVISION_BASE:
+   uv_hubbed_system = 0x3;
+   break;
+   }
+
pnodeid = early_get_pnodeid();
early_get_apic_socketid_shift();
 
@@ -359,6 +378,12 @@ int is_uv_system(void)
 }
 EXPORT_SYMBOL_GPL(is_uv_system);
 
+int is_uv_hubbed(int uvtype)
+{
+   return (uv_hubbed_system & uvtype);
+}
+EXPORT_SYMBOL_GPL(is_uv_hubbed);
+
 int is_uv_hubless(int uvtype)
 {
return (uv_hubless_system & uvtype);
@@ -1457,6 +1482,68 @@ static void __init build_socket_tables(v
}
 }
 
+/* Setup user proc fs files */
+static int proc_hubbed_show(struct seq_file *file, void *data)
+{
+   seq_printf(file, "0x%x\n", uv_hubbed_system);
+   return 0;
+}
+
+static int proc_hubless_show(struct seq_file *file, void *data)
+{
+   seq_printf(file, "0x%x\n", uv_hubless_system);
+   return 0;
+}
+
+static int proc_oemid_show(struct seq_file *file, void *data)
+{
+   seq_printf(file, "%s/%s\n", oem_id, oem_table_id);
+   return 0;
+}
+
+static int proc_hubbed_open(struct inode *inode, struct file *file)
+{
+   return single_open(file, proc_hubbed_show, (void *)NULL);
+}
+
+static int proc_hubless_open(struct inode *inode, struct file *file)
+{
+   return single_open(file, proc_hubless_show, (void *)NULL);
+}
+
+static int proc_oemid_open(struct inode *inode, struct file *file)
+{
+   return single_open(file, proc_oemid_show, (void *)NULL);
+}
+
+/* (struct is "non-const" as open function is set at runtime) */
+static struct file_operations proc_version_fops = {
+   .read   = seq_read,
+   .llseek = seq_lseek,
+   .release= single_release,
+};
+
+static const struct file_operations proc_oemid_fops = {
+   .open   = proc_oemid_open,
+   .read   = seq_read,
+   .llseek = seq_lseek,
+   .release= single_release,
+};
+
+static __init void uv_setup_proc_files(int hubless)
+{
+   struct proc_dir_entry *pde;
+   char *name = hubless ? "hubless" : "hubbed";
+
+   pde = proc_mkdir(UV_PROC_NODE, NULL);
+   proc_create("oemid", 0, pde, _oemid_fops);
+   proc_create(name, 0, pde, _version_fops);
+   if (hubless)
+   proc_version_fops.open = proc_hubless_open;
+   else
+   proc_version_fops.open = proc_hubbed_open;
+}
+
 /* Initialize UV
